Galaxy GeForce GTX 660Ti 2GB GC Pictured and Detailed

Galaxy’s card has been updated with a new cooler. While GTX 670 and GTX 680 have similar ones, this has a new version, which looks more futuristic.

The heatsink is identical, also the heatpipes are in the same number and placed the same way. It looks like Galaxy only refreshed the cooler shroud, which is kept in silver color.

Card is featuring a factory-overclocked clocks of 1006/1084/6008 MHz for base, boost and memory, most of the non-overclocked models featured such clocks.

We know that MSI’S GTX 660 Ti Power Edition will feature a TDP up to 190W. But if we compare this to Galaxy’s 225W power consumption, we can guess which card is more powerful. It does also feature 5+2 phase power design (same as MSI’s PE). Galaxy took care of the power section, by providing an additional heatsink to cover it.

The PCB itself looks very interesting. It has been divided into two modules, where the primary is more like a reference card, and the additional board delivers all the juicy stuff for overclocking. This includes more powerful power section and 6+8 power connectors.

What’s more, it comes in variants 2GB or 3GB of memory, divided into 8 or 12 Hynix chips. These are all GDDR5 modules with a memory latency of 0.3 ns.

Galaxy provided the slides with a overclocking performance, where it beats the GTX 670. There’s also a gaming performance chart, where GTX 660 Ti only lost in Aliens vs Predator. These charts show how overclocking can increase the maximum performance. But we better off wait for more valid reviews to compare how it performs.

Card is equipped with default display outputs: two DVI’s, one HDMI and DisplayPort. Galaxy GTX 660 Ti GC 2GB offered for $350, while the 3GB version is not yet detailed.
